Why won't my Mantis Tiller engine start?

Several factors can prevent your Mantis Tiller's engine from starting. Ensure the “o/i” switch is in the “i” position. Check for fuel in the tank and refill if necessary. A clogged fuel filter or fuel line can also be the culprit, so replace the filter or clean the fuel line. Inspect the spark plug; if it's shorted, fouled, or broken, install a new one. Also, check the ignition lead wire for shorts, breaks, or disconnections and replace or reattach it. Finally, a clogged diaphragm can prevent the engine from starting, in which case you should replace the diaphragm.
